    MANDATE

    This role is enterprise-wide in scope and reports to the Director, Sustainability Strategy, Disclosure & Impact, and the Senior Advisor, Sustainability Strategy, Disclosure & Impact. The Manager supports the Sustainability team in identifying key sustainability issues and advancing management programs relating to BMO's Environmental, Social and Governance (ESG) and Sustainability performance. The Manager supports the enterprise sustainability and climate strategy, impact measurement, and management reporting/disclosure.

    The holder of the role has subject matter expertise and draws on knowledge and experience in sustainability and climate change. The role requires someone with strong problem solving, research and analysis, written and verbal communication and project management skills.

    K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ES

    GHG quantification

    • Monitor developments and provide subject-matter expertise on GHG accounting and target-setting principles and methodologies including those of the GHG Protocol, ISO , Partnership for Carbon Accounting Financials (PCAF), Net Zero Banking Alliance (NZBA), Science-based Targets Initiative (SBTi), others.
    • Lead quantification of BMO's operational gre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ions accounting in accordance with the GHG Protocol, including Scope 1, Scope 2 and operational Scope 3 categories.
    • Work with Corporate Real Estate team to collect, track and report BMO's operational efficiency metrics including energy consumption, GHG emissions, waste management, and water consumption.
    • Implement, maintain and optimize GHG quantification software.
    • Lead third-party assurance processes related to Scope 1, Scope 2 and Scope 3 emissions including financed and facilitated emissions.
    • Support and advise on target-setting approaches for operational, financed and facilitated emissions in accordance with related initiatives (e.g. SBTi, Net Zero Banking Alliance (NZBA), others) based on an understanding of sectoral decarbonization pathways.
    • Support the team in developing and implementing strategy related to operational greenhouse gas (GHG) reductions / decarbonization and carbon neutrality.

    Disclosure

    • Support, as part of a broader team:
      • Development of the content of BMO's Climate Report in accordance with voluntary and regulatory frameworks (e.g. TCFD, PCAF, NZBA, OSFI B-15, OSFI Risk Return, ISSB/CSSB, CSRD).
      • Development of enterprise-wide Climate Transition Plan and related strategic initiatives in accordance with regulatory requirements (e.g. OSFI B-15) and global guidance (e.g. GFANZ).

    Impact Measurement

    • Monitor emerging sustainability and climate-related metrics and make recommendations related to adoption, methodology and calculation approaches.
    • Support and advise on the development and evolution of BMO's Sustainable and Climate Finance Directive and methodology to support the bank's credible growth of sustainable finance
    • Develop and implement impact measurement approaches for sustainable and climate finance

    Other

    • Implement robust data governance procedures and controls to produce reliable, accurate, complete and transparent reporting that is auditable.
    • Support the enterprise climate and sustainability data and analytics program in relation to financed emissions quantification and sustainable and climate finance identification and tracking.
    • Support preparation of presentations and messaging for senior management and executives on sustainability and climate-related topics, as needed.
    • Assistance in developing and executing other sustainability related programs as may be needed.
    • Actively participate in and represent BMO in industry association working groups as such as those of the UNEP FI, Canadian Bankers Association, PCAF, NZBA, others.

    KNOWLEDGE AND SKILLS

    • Degree in a related field such as sustainability, climate, business, finance, engineering, accounting. Masters-level preferred.
    • 5 - 7 years' experience in a financial institution, the commercial real estate sector and/or a sustainability-related field is an asset.
    • Advanced knowledge and proven application of operational GHG accounting and reporting based on the GHG Protocol and the ISO standard: Specification with guidance at the organization level for quantification and reporting of greenhouse gas emissions and removals.
    • Advanced knowledge and proven application of the PCAF Global GHG Standards for financed emissions quantification and an understanding of facilitated emissions methodologies.
    • Understanding of SBTi's criteria on operational GHG reduction target setting.
    • Understanding of the Net Zero Banking Alliance (NZBA) commitment requirements and target-setting guidance.
    • Strong ability to translate quantitative analysis in to findings, conclusions and recommendations.
    • Strong written and verbal communication skills
    • Strong relationship management skills and well-developed negotiation skills
    • Strong critical thinking, problem solving skills and ability to navigate ambiguous situations.
    • Self-starter and motivated
    • Ability to work independently with little oversight
    • Strong project management skills and ability to handle multiple tasks, change priorities and operate effectively in a fast paced environment
    • Results oriented and goal driven
    • Politically astute, diplomatic and able to navigate complex corporate and external environment with numerous stakeholders on highly sensitive and controversial topics
    • Strong change management skills
